Wrigley opened in 1914, making it the second-oldest active MLB ballpark behind Fenway. Fans love the remaining legacy elements of the stadium, including ivy-covered outfield walls and a hand-turned scoreboard over the center-field stands.What is the oldest active MLB Stadium in the game? The answer to that question is Fenway Park. The ballpark first opened up in 1912 making the venue over 100 years old. The venue is home to the Boston Red Sox baseball team.Here is a look at all 30 Major League parks in use today, from oldest to newest. Fenway Park (1912) – Famous for its 37-foot-high Green Monster left-field wall and other idiosyncratic dimensions, Fenway Park is the oldest and one of the smallest ballparks currently in use in the Major Leagues.

What is the second oldest stadium in MLB?

Wrigley opened in 1914, making it the second-oldest active MLB ballpark behind Fenway. Fans love the remaining legacy elements of the stadium, including ivy-covered outfield walls and a hand-turned scoreboard over the center-field stands.

Where was the first baseball stadium with a retractable roof?

Rogers Centre

In June 1989, Toronto unveiled the SkyDome to much pomp and circumstance. It was the first stadium with a fully retractable roof, creating the best of both weather worlds for the CFL’s Argonauts and MLB’s Blue Jays.

Which state is home to the oldest professional baseball park in the US?

Located in Birmingham, Alabama, Rickwood Field is the oldest professional baseball park in the United States. Built for the Birmingham Barons in 1910, it’s now undergoing gradual restoration as a “working museum.” The Barons play one regular season game a year at Rickwood Field.

What is the oldest stadium in professional sports?

1. Melbourne Cricket Ground (Melbourne, Australia) The oldest continuously operating sports arena in the world is also one of the largest, with a capacity of over 100,000. Built in 1854, it has grown into an enormous spectacle, hosting events for one of the fasting growing sports in the world.

What is the oldest professional sports stadium in the United States?

Harvard Stadium, 1903

Harvard Stadium is 118 years old this fall, and is the nation’s oldest permanent concrete structure for intercollegiate athletics. It was the host of the New England Patriots from 1971 until 1972, and today has a 30,323-seat capacity.
